Accessing a camera feed that you do not own, without explicit permission, is unauthorized access . In most jurisdictions, this is illegal. It can violate computer fraud and abuse laws, privacy laws, and data protection regulations. It is never ethical to view or interact with a private video feed without the owner's consent, even if it is technically accessible.

The search string inurl:axis-cgi/mjpg/video.cgi is a well-known "Google Dork" used to find publicly accessible Axis network cameras broadcasting live Motion JPEG (MJPEG) streams.
